Understanding Mifepristone for Abortion
Mifepristone is a key component in medication abortion procedures. It interferes with the hormone progesterone, which supports a pregnancy. By stopping progesterone's effects, mifepristone leads to the lining of the uterus shedding, effectively ending the pregnancy.
Medication abortion typically involves two medications: mifepristone followed by misoprostol. Mifepristone needs to be consumed orally, and misoprostol is used vaginally some days later to induce cramping. The process can vary depending on individual circumstances and medical guidance.
- It's crucial to medication abortion should only be performed under the guidance from a qualified healthcare provider.
- Side effects might encompass cramping, bleeding, nausea, and fatigue. These symptoms are usually not severe.

ED Drug Benefits and Drawbacks
When it comes to addressing erectile dysfunction (ED), men have a variety of medication options at their disposal. Each drug offers a unique set of advantages, but also carries potential drawbacks. Understanding these nuances is crucial for making an informed decision about the best treatment plan. Some popular ED medications include sildenafil (Viagra), tadalafil (Cialis), and vardenafil (Levitra). Sildenafil typically works by widening blood vessels in the penis, allowing for increased blood flow during sexual stimulation. Tadalafil is known for its longer-lasting effects, sometimes lasting up to 36 hours. Vardenafil, similar to sildenafil, also focuses on improving blood flow to the penis.
It's important to note that these medications are not suitable for everyone. Men with certain underlying illnesses, such as heart disease or low blood pressure, should consult their doctor before taking ED drugs. Common complications can include headache, dizziness, and indigestion. In some cases, more serious issues may occur.
